Anthropic's $100B AWS Deal, OpenAI Images 2.0, and Microsoft's Agentic Web

from AI Convo Cast · host AI Convo Cast

In this episode, we discuss Anthropic's massive hundred billion dollar commitment to Amazon Web Services, OpenAI's launch of Images 2.0 in ChatGPT, and Microsoft's ambitious plan to build the infrastructure layer for the agentic web. We break down how Anthropic is securing up to five gigawatts of compute capacity powered by Amazon's custom Trainium chips, what OpenAI's upgraded image generation model means for text rendering and professional design workflows, and why Microsoft is positioning itself to define the protocols and standards governing AI agent interoperability.
